I know there is a link out there on this, but I cant find it....I am trying to find out how to turn my chest freezer into a fermentation chamber..Can anyone help?

If it's big enough to sit your fermenter in, you just need an external temp controller like this: http://www.northernbrewer.com/brewi...-control/johnson-refrigerator-thermostat.html You plug it into the wall, plug the freezer into the controller, put the controller's temp probe inside the freezer and dial in the temp you want.
